not too shabbywas given a can of Wander draught and looked upon it dubiously yet free is free and so i used it to baptise my new keg setup brewed it with coopers no.1 and 400g of redgum honey with a sg of 1046 and a final gravity of 1012 it went straight into the keg and was drinking it 72 hours later. not too shabby perhaps a little low in bitterness for my tastes yet altogether drinkable 1/2 a keg gone in a week need i say more... |

Try it with Coopers BE2Brewed it with Coopers Brew Enhancer 2 (Dex, LDME & Maltodextrin 1kg blend) and Safale S-04 (batch size was 23 litres). Brew temps were at the low end of the Safale (15-17 deg C). Racked after 6 days & then 7 days in secondary. Bulk primed with 130 grams dex (batch size was 18 litres after racking). SG started at 1042 & finished at 1017. I was a bit worried that fermentation hadn't finished & bottle bombs might have been in order, but it was still 1017 after 10 days in the bottle. Taste is not bad at all. It's a nicely carbed light malty ale. I'm not sure I would call this brew value for money, as I spent more on the extras than on the kit, but it turned out ok. Give it a try if you find it on sale. |
